When Will EPF Interest Be Credited for FY24

When Will EPF Interest Be Credited for FY24: The interest on provident fund deposits for the Financial Year 2023-24 (FY24) is eagerly awaited by salaried workers.

The Employees’ Provident Fund Organisation (EPFO) increased the interest rate on deposits from 8.15 percent to 8.25 percent in February. Interest is calculated monthly and contributions are deposited annually.

EPFO responded to a query regarding EPFO’s interest in social media platform X (formerly Twitter);

“The process is in the pipeline and may be shown there very shortly. Whenever the interest will be credited, it will be accumulated and paid in full. There would be no loss of interest.”

By March 2024, 281.7 million EPFO members had been credited with interest for FY23.

A mandatory retirement and savings plan for salaried employees is the EPF. According to EPF regulations, employees are required to contribute 12 percent of their basic pay to this fund each month. In addition to matching the contributions, employers also contribute to employees’ PF accounts. The Central Board of Trustees of EPFO reviews the interest rate on EPF deposits annually.

The EPFO website, missed calls, SMS, and the Umang App allow members to check their EPF balance in a variety of ways. They can also track their contributions, interest earned, and overall balance by accessing their passbooks.

Here’s how to check your EPF  balance online:

  • EPF’s official website can be found here.
  • Enter your UAN (Universal Account Number), password, and captcha code to log in.
  • Navigate to the e-Passbook section after logging in.
  • If you have more than one member ID, select the one that applies.
  • The screen will display your total EPF balance.

How to check your EPF balance on UMANG app:

  • Install the UMANG app on your smartphone.
  • From the list of services, select EPFO.
  • Go to the employee centric services section.
  • Passbook can be viewed by selecting View Passbook.
  • Please enter your UAN number and password.
  • Your registered mobile number will receive an OTP.
  • To authenticate your identity, enter the OTP.
  • The UMANG app now allows you to view your EPF balance.
